How Our Team Handles Broken Pipe Water Removal
Our process for broken pipe water removal is designed to be efficient, effective, and stress-free for you. We understand that every minute counts when dealing with water damage, which is why we focus on rapid response times and a clear communication plan.
Step 1: Emergency Response and Assessment
Our team arrives quickly to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. We’ll take note of any affected are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ings, and develop a plan to mitigate further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property, including industrial wet/dry vacuums and sump pumps. Our technicians will work efficiently to reduce drying time and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Our IICRC-certified technicians will th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as, including surfaces, walls, and floors. This step is essential in removing any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may have entered your home through the water damage.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Once your property has been thoroughly cleaned and dried,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ing damaged walls, floors, or ceilings, as well as replacing any affected materials.

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ost in Wickenburg, AZ
The cost of broken pipe water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wickenburg, AZ.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$200-$1,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500-$2,500 | Amount of water, equ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$300-$1,500 | Severity of damage, materials needed |
| Restoration and Repair |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, materials needed |
| Free Estimate and Consultation | $0-$200 | Location, severity of damage |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ates and consultations to help you understand the scope of the damage and the cost of the service.

Common Questions About Broken Pipe Water Removal
Will my insurance cover the cost of broken pipe water removal?
Yes, most insurance policies cover water damage, including broken pipe water removal.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on your provider and coverage. We recommend contacting your insurance company to confirm coverage and file a claim.
How long will it take to complete the water removal process?
The length of time it takes to complete the water removal process dep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ed. Our team will work efficiently to reduce drying time and prevent further damage. On average, the process takes 3-5 days to complete.
Will you need to remove my belongings or furniture?
Our team will work with you to find out the best course of action for your belongings and furniture. In some cases, we may need to remove items that are damaged beyond repair or pose a health hazard. But, we will always work with you to reduce disruption and ensure your belongings are handled with care.
How do I prevent water damage from broken pipes?
Preventing water damage from broken pipes need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es regularly for signs of wear and tear, and consider installing freeze-proof faucets or frost-proof spigots in areas prone to freezing temperatures. You should also keep an eye out for musty odors, water stains, and other warning signs of potential water damage.
What equipment do you use for water removal?
We use a variety of equipment, including industrial wet/dry vacuums, sump pumps, and dehumidifiers, to extract water and dry out your property. Our technicians are trained to use this equipment effectively and efficiently to reduce drying time and prevent further damage.
